Explore the science behind global temperature shifts, atmospheric circulation, and human contributions driving climate change. The overview navigates climate dynamics, greenhouse gas impacts, paleoclimate evidence, and modeling techniques while shedding light on mitigation strategies and socio-economic stakes in climate policy. Climate science seeks to understand the mechanisms driving global temperature shifts, atmospheric circulation, and the human influence on Earth's systems. Addressing modern climate challenges requires interdisciplinary approaches and scientific literacy. Introduction to Modern Climate Change presents a clear and comprehensive overview of climate dynamics, greenhouse gas effects, and the role of human activity in global warming. The book discusses paleoclimate evidence, modeling techniques, and mitigation strategies. It also explores the socio-economic dimensions of climate policy and adaptation. Written with clarity and scientific rigor, it serves as an essential resource for students, researchers, and anyone seeking to understand climate change in the modern context.
